Roof damage in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roofing system to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. These inspections typically include a detailed visual examination of the roof’s surface, flashing, gutters, and other components, often supplemented by the use of specialized tools or equipment. The goal is to detect signs of damage such as missing or broken shingles, leaks, structural weaknesses, and areas susceptible to future problems. By pinpointing these concerns early, property owners can address issues before they develop into more extensive and costly repairs.

This service helps resolve common roofing problems that can compromise the integrity of a building. Identifying leaks, storm damage, or deterioration caused by weather exposure can prevent water intrusion, mold growth, and structural damage. Roof inspections also assist in evaluating whether repairs or replacements are necessary, ensuring that property owners make informed decisions. Regular inspections can extend the lifespan of a roof by catching issues early, reducing the likelihood of unexpected failures that could lead to interior damage or more significant structural concerns.

The overview below groups typical Roof Damage Inspection proj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wethersfield, CT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Inspection Costs - The cost for a roof damage inspection typically ranges from $150 to $500,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ex roofs may cost more, sometimes exceeding $600.

Assessment Fees - Assessment fees from local service providers generally fall between $100 and $400. These fees cover a thorough evaluation of roof conditions to identify damage or potential issues.

Additional Charges - Additional charges may apply for detailed reports or drone inspections, often adding $50 to $200 to the initial inspection cost. These services can help provide a comprehensive view of roof damage.

Factors Affecting Cost - Costs can vary based on roof height, accessibility, and extent of damage. For example, inspecting a single-story home might be less expensive than a multi-story building in Wethersfield, CT.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s of roof damage? Common indicators include missing or broken shingles, water stains on ceilings, and visible sagging or curling of roof materials.

How can a roof damage inspection help? An inspection can identify issues early, preventing further damage and helping to determine necessary repairs or maintenance.

Who should perform a roof damage inspection? Qualified local contractors or service providers specializing in roof assessments can conduct thorough inspections.

How often should a roof be inspected? Regular inspections are recommended after severe weather events and at least once a year to maintain roof health.

What damages are typically found during an inspection? Common findings include cracked or missing shingles, damaged flashing, and signs of water intrusion or leaks.
